Executive Whitepaper Summary: China's Role in Global Weather-Resistant PE Masterbatch Manufacturing

The global demand for high-durability outdoor sunshade netting, agricultural shading fabrics, and construction safety screens has accelerated the need for ultra-weather-resistant Polyethylene (PE) masterbatches. Polyethylene monofilaments and flat tape yarns used in exterior shade nets are constantly subjected to severe photo-thermal oxidation caused by solar ultraviolet (UV) radiation, ambient thermal loads exceeding 50°C, and exposure to agrochemicals.

China's masterbatch manufacturing sector—led by integrated enterprise hubs in Jiangsu and Zhejiang provinces—has evolved into the global benchmark for high-concentration, additive-stabilized PE masterbatches. By pairing virgin low-density (LDPE) and linear low-density polyethylene (LLDPE) carrier resins with high-molecular-weight Hindered Amine Light Stabilizers (HALS), organic UV absorbers, micro-fine carbon black, and heat-stabilized organic pigments, Chinese factories produce masterbatches that ensure extended outdoor service lives ranging from 3 to 10 years even in desert or tropical climatological zones.

Photochemistry & Additive Engineering in Weather-Resistant PE Masterbatch

Photodegradation Dynamics in Polyethylene Matrices

Unstabilized high-density polyethylene (HDPE) and linear low-density polyethylene (LLDPE) exposed to outdoor sunlight experience photon absorption primarily in the UV-A (315–400 nm) and UV-B (280–315 nm) spectral bands. This absorption initiates Norrish Type I and Type II photochemical reactions, breaking polymer C-C and C-H backbones and forming free alkyl radicals (R·). In the presence of atmospheric oxygen, these radicals convert into peroxy radicals (ROO·), propagating auto-catalytic chain scission, cross-linking, surface chalking, micro-cracking, and rapid loss of tensile elongation.

Technical Core: For outdoor sunshade nets, tensile strength retention is paramount. A loss of 50% tensile strength leads to tearing under wind shear. Chinese masterbatch formulations mitigate this through a tri-stage stabilization system involving primary antioxidants, secondary phosphites, and polymeric HALS.

Hindered Amine Light Stabilizers (HALS)

Polymeric HALS (such as HALS 944 and HALS 622) operate via the Denisov Cycle, continuously scavenging nitroxyl radicals without being consumed. High molecular weight minimizes migration and volatilization during 260°C monofilament spinning.

UV Absorbers & Synergy

Synergistic blending of Triazine UV absorbers with Hydroxyphenyl-benzotriazoles converts damaging UV photons into harmless thermal energy via reversible keto-enol tautomerism, protecting deeper layers of extruded shade yarns.

Nano-Carbon Black Attenuation

For black agricultural shade nets, high-purity furnace carbon black (particle size 18–22 nm) acts as a physical UV shield. At a 40%–50% masterbatch concentration, it absorbs across the entire solar spectrum while providing thermal dissipation.

Global Enterprise Procurement Criteria & Quality Standards

Professional B2B buyers, shade net manufacturers, and extrusion plants evaluate Chinese masterbatch suppliers against strict physical, thermal, and regulatory benchmarks.

1. Melt Index Matching & Carrier Resin Compatibility

The Melt Flow Index (MFI) of the masterbatch carrier must precisely match or slightly exceed the matrix resin (typically MFI 0.8 to 4.0 g/10min at 190°C/2.16kg for monofilament extrusion). Mismatched MFI leads to phase separation, melt fracture, uneven color banding, and yarn breakage during high-speed drawing (draw ratios 1:4 to 1:6).

2. Filter Pressure Value (FPV) & Dispersion Index

For fine monofilament extrusion (diameters 0.15 mm – 0.30 mm), masterbatch particle dispersion is critical. Top-tier Chinese manufacturers enforce a strict Filter Pressure Value (DIN EN 13900-5) below 1.0 bar/g using 14-micron screen packs. This eliminates agglomerates that cause spinneret clogging and fiber snapping.

3. Agrochemical Resistance & Pesticide Tolerance

Agricultural shade nets are frequently exposed to acidic pesticides, sulfur burners, and halogenated agrochemicals. Standard HALS compounds react with acidic residues, deactivating UV protection. Leading Chinese factories formulate masterbatches using NOR-HALS (amino-ether HALS), ensuring non-reactivity with sulfur and halogen ions for greenhouse shade cloth applications.

Technology Roadmap: Next-Generation Outdoor PE Masterbatches

The future of sunshade net masterbatch compounding is defined by functional spectrum filtering, non-PFAS processing aids, and eco-friendly circular polymer carriers.

01

Photoselective PAR Tuning

Integration of spectral-shifting additives that convert UV radiation into Photosynthetically Active Radiation (PAR, 400–700 nm) to boost agricultural crop growth while shielding plants from extreme IR heat.

02

PFAS-Free Polymer Processing Aids

Transitioning from traditional fluoroelastomer PPAs to organic bio-based fluoro-free process aids, ensuring compliance with global PFAS bans while maintaining extrusion melt smoothness.

03

rPE Recycled Carrier Systems

Developing masterbatches with upcycled post-consumer Polyethylene (rPE) carrier resins enhanced by reactive chain extenders for zero-carbon shade net production.

04

Near-Infrared (NIR) Reflective Pigments

Incorporating functional NIR-reflecting inorganic oxides into colored masterbatches to reduce surface temperature of architectural shade sails by up to 12°C.

Quality Control Protocols & Regulatory Compliance

Premium Chinese masterbatch suppliers maintain strict quality assurance workflows certified under ISO 9001:2015 and ISO 14001:2015 management systems. Every batch destined for export undergoes rigorous laboratory testing before shipment:

Spectrophotometric Color Matching

Using X-Rite Datacolor spectrophotometers to guarantee color consistency within ΔE < 0.5 under D65, A, and F11 light sources across all production runs.

Accelerated Weathering (QUV & Xenon)

Testing samples under ASTM G154 (QUV UV-A 340nm exposure) and ISO 4892-2 (Xenon arc light exposure) to verify 3,000 to 5,000-hour light fastness rating (8 Grade on Blue Wool Scale).

Heavy Metal & Chemical Compliance

Formulations fully compliant with EU REACH SVHC candidate list, RoHS Directive 2011/65/EU (RoHS 3.0), and FDA 21 CFR 177.1520 food-contact suitability for agricultural crop netting.

Global Industry Applications & Regional Demands

Tailored masterbatch formulations adapted to distinct regional weather extremes, solar irradiance levels, and industrial requirements worldwide.

Middle East & GCC Countries

Conditions: UV Index 11+, ambient temperatures > 50°C, sandstorm abrasion.
Solution: High LDR (4%-5%) PE Black Masterbatch with 40% furnace carbon black and NOR-HALS to prevent thermal embrittlement in desert shade structures.

Southern Europe & Mediterranean

Conditions: Intense summer solar exposure, active pesticide application in vineyards and orchards.
Solution: Green and White PE Color Masterbatches with pesticide-resistant HALS and anti-blooming non-migration additives.

Australia & New Zealand

Conditions: Severe UV radiation due to ozone depletion, strict UPF 50+ human shade standards.
Solution: High-density TiO2 White and Silver Masterbatch offering high solar reflection and skin-safe UPF ratings for school/park shade sails.

Frequently Asked Questions (FAQ) for Masterbatch Buyers & Engineers
What is the recommended Let-Down Ratio (LDR) for weather-resistant PE masterbatch in sunshade net production?
For standard outdoor sunshade nets requiring a 3-to-5-year lifespan, the recommended Let-Down Ratio (LDR) ranges between 2.0% and 4.0% depending on the pigment concentration and active HALS loading in the masterbatch. For extreme desert environments (e.g., Middle East or Arizona) or 8-to-10-year lifespan guarantees, an LDR of 4.0% to 5.0% is advised to maintain tensile retention above 80% after prolonged outdoor exposure.
How does HALS selection differ between PE monofilament yarn and flat tape film extrusion?
Monofilament yarns undergo high-draw ratios at elevated temperatures (up to 260°C), requiring ultra-high molecular weight polymeric HALS (e.g., HALS 944) with low volatility to prevent gasification and spinning breaks. Flat tape yarns have a larger surface-area-to-volume ratio, making them more susceptible to surface oxidation; hence, a synergistic combination of low-molecular-weight and high-molecular-weight HALS is utilized to provide both immediate surface protection and long-term bulk polymer stabilization.
Can PE color masterbatches withstand chemical pesticides used in greenhouse agricultural shade netting?
Standard basic HALS compounds can react with acidic pesticide residues (such as elemental sulfur burners or halogenated insecticides), leading to deactivation of the UV stabilizer and early net embrittlement. To solve this, specialized Chinese factories formulate agricultural shade net masterbatches using Amino-Ether HALS (NOR-HALS), which are non-basic and remain completely inert in the presence of acidic crop protection chemicals.
What is Filter Pressure Value (FPV), and why is it crucial for fine denier monofilament extrusion?
Filter Pressure Value (FPV) measures the buildup of melt pressure behind a screen pack caused by un-dispersed pigment agglomerates during masterbatch extrusion (tested according to EN 13900-5). An FPV rating below 1.0 bar/g is required for fine monofilaments (0.15–0.25 mm diameter). Higher FPV values cause screen pack clogging, frequent extruder shutdowns, and micro-voids in the shade net yarn that lead to yarn snapping under tension.
How do Chinese masterbatch factories ensure color fastness and prevent dye migration in outdoor shade fabrics?
Top Chinese masterbatch companies utilize high-performance organic pigments (such as Phthalocyanine Blue/Green, Quinacridones, and Isoindolinones) and coated inorganic titanium dioxide/iron oxides that feature high heat stability (≥ 260°C) and light fastness ratings of 7 to 8 on the Blue Wool Scale. Anti-migration additives are co-extruded to prevent pigment chalking, blooming, or bleeding when shade fabrics are exposed to rain and high humidity.
What certifications should international buyers require when purchasing masterbatches for sunshade net manufacturing?
International procurement teams should verify that masterbatch suppliers hold ISO 9001:2015 quality system certification, REACH SVHC compliance documentation, and RoHS 3.0 test reports from accredited third-party labs (such as SGS or TÜV). If shade nets are intended for agricultural food-crop shading or water collection catchments, compliance with FDA 21 CFR 177.1520 for olefin polymers is also mandatory.
